I got my twins graduated from college last Saturday and had them home for a week! They headed for Atlanta yesterday so it was time to go fishing. My wife said have at it, so off I went. I headed to my favorite stream--the Smith in Virginia. It is a 3 1/2 hour drive one way. I had a late start and arrived at Martinsville at around 2:30. By the time I had filled up with gas I decided not to go way upstream because I was running late. I started out at the end of the old special regs. I saw a few sulfurs popping off and some midges but I was in a beetle mood. I had 1 eat a beetle and that was it. I loaded up and went further downstream to escape the midges and sulfurs and find some hungry fish. I stopped at a place that doesn't have a lot of fish but they are a little bigger on average. I caught a few there and rolled on downstream to where I normally finish up. Took me a few minutes to get wired in but I finished up with a few more and headed home. I didn't catch a ton of fish but I caught a few nice ones for the Smith. I caught 5 or 6 little ones and the rest were in the slot.
